欢迎来到我的博客

这里是我分享学习心得、技术探索与生活点滴的小天地。无论是前端开发、后端架构,还是日常随笔,我都希望通过文字记录下每一次进步与思考。

在这里,你可以看到我的项目实践、编程经验、遇到的难题与解决方案,也能感受到我对生活的热爱与追求。

感谢你的到访,愿我们在知识的世界里共同成长,不断前行!

async方法

JavaScript 的 async 用于声明异步函数,配合 await 可暂停代码执行直到 Promise 结果返回,简化异步流程,提升代码可读性和维护性。

了解更多

组件事件

Vue组件事件用于实现子组件与父组件之间的通信。子组件通过$emit方法触发自定义事件,并可携带参数,父组件通过v-on或@监听这些事件并执行相应逻辑。这样可以实现数据传递、状态同步和响应用户操作,提升组件解耦性和复用性。常用于表单、按钮、弹窗等场景,便于父组件根据子组件行为做出响应。

了解更多

自定义指令

Vue自定义指令用于扩展HTML标签功能,可实现DOM操作、事件监听等。通过 Vue.directive 注册,常用钩子有 bind、inserted、update 等。适合处理复用性强、与DOM直接交互的场景,如自动聚焦、权限控制、拖拽等,提升开发效率与代码复用性。

了解更多

grid布局

CSS3 Grid布局是一种强大的二维布局系统, 主要属性有: grid(启用网格),grid-template-rows / grid-template-columns(定义行列),grid-gap(设置间距),grid-area(区域命名),justify-items和align-items(对齐方式)等。 它支持响应式设计,简化复杂页面结构,提升开发效率,适合实现多栏、网格等布局需求。

了解更多